site stats

Software developers talk about technical debt

WebMar 28, 2024 · A great software architecture contributes the following to development: It serves as a basis for communication between all stakeholders (users, customer, product management, etc.) All relevant and important software-related, technical and user-related decisions are considered at this stage; It defines the model of the software and how it will ... WebNov 30, 2024 · The time invested here is much higher than the time needed to implement the full functionality in the first place. It’s the fee we pay, the pay off of our debt. Its effects are …

What is Technical Debt and How to Avoid It? - SoftwareHut

WebMay 9, 2024 · The term “Technical Debt“ was coined by Ward Cunningham (creator of the wiki and co-author of Extreme Programming) in 1992 to better conceptualize an abstract issue to non-technical stakeholders. This metaphor to financial debt was so appropriate because technical debt, too allows you to invest early on, but can be really dangerous if … WebMay 25, 2024 · Put simply, technical debt is the outcome of implementation of the simplified and short-term solutions in development, which lead to constantly increasing expenses … bird drinking fountain https://wedyourmovie.com

Erasing tech debt: A leader

WebNov 2, 2024 · Technical debt is a concept of skipping or postponing particular works to finish and deliver the project on time. And that work becomes debt because, in the end, it … WebJan 31, 2024 · In fact, most projects rely on third party and legacy code, managing the quality and security of such a large portion of the project’s code base leads to the topic of technical debt. Technical Debt. The strict definition of technical debt “the extra development work that arises when code that is easy to implement in the short run is used ... WebHoward G. Cunningham (born May 26, 1949) is an American computer programmer who developed the first wiki and was a co-author of the Manifesto for Agile Software Development.A pioneer in both design patterns and extreme programming, he started coding the WikiWikiWeb in 1994, and installed it on c2.com (the website of his software … dalton ohio truck beds

How to Calculate Technical Debt and Express It Clearly - ThinkApps

Category:Mark MacMahon – Chief Technology Officer - LinkedIn

Tags:Software developers talk about technical debt

Software developers talk about technical debt

Technical Debt: Definition, Types & Example - ProjectManager

WebAshland, Virginia, United States. Empathy is a critical technical skill. When empathy is embedded in your organization, you can enjoy faster deployments, less technical debt, happier customers and ... WebIn the end, software architecture will inevitably result in having lots of “technical debts”. Although technical debt is inevitable, but it is a problem of quantity as a matter of fact. How did technical debt arise? I think technical debt has mainly three categories. Doucment Debts. 1. Requirements Debts; 2. Development Document Debts; 3.

Software developers talk about technical debt

Did you know?

WebOct 11, 2024 · Due to a lack of skills, knowledge, and experience, software development leads to technical debt. Inadvertent and prudent. Inadvertent and prudent debt is where … WebApr 5, 2024 · Technical debt has bounced into the spotlight after major system failures hit US aviation hard, forcing executive leaders to consider their own risk. Mike Mason and Rachel Laycock, Thoughtworks’ Global Heads of Technology and Enterprise Modernization, explore why addressing tech debt matters and how doing so can benefit your bottom line.

WebJun 29, 2024 · Instead, technical debt has come to refer to anything developers don’t really want to talk about. Cunningham attributed this confusion about technical debt’s definition to tech bloggers, ... “In software-intensive systems, technical debt consists of design or implementation constructs that are expedient in the short term, ... WebUltimately, tech debt — also known as tech debt or code debt — is inevitable and is part of any software development process. ... And to do that, we need to talk about types of tech …

WebFinances – Tech debt itself drives up development costs. The impact of tech debt drives down revenue. Survival – We’re talking bankruptcy. No, seriously. Check out our Tech … WebMar 1, 2024 · Here’s what Wikipedia says: "Technical Debt is a concept that reflects the implied cost of additional rework caused by choosing an easy (limited) solution now …

WebIn software development, technical debt (also known as design debt or code debt) is the implied cost of future reworking required when choosing an easy but limited solution instead of a better approach that could take more time.. Analogous with monetary debt, if technical debt is not repaid, it can accumulate "interest", making it harder to implement changes.

WebGood tech debt is accrued prudently and deliberately to ship faster. There’s always a plan to pay back good tech debt. Bad tech debt is usually accrued inadvertently or recklessly. Or … dalton ohio boys basketballWebJul 20, 2024 · Lines of code (LOC) — the total number of code lines. Cost per line (CPL) in hours — time to write a line of code. Remediation cost in hours — time to make a repair. … dalton ny schoolWebMar 9, 2024 · Here are some methods to identify technical debt in software development: 1. Code Review Code review is the process by which developers check the code of their … dalton ohio local schoolsWebExperienced Technology Leader with a track record of building happy, high-performing cross-functional product development teams. I support companies with: PRODUCT and TECH STRATEGY • Vision for the role technology plays in support of the business and the roadmap to that vision. OKRs, company bets and technical … dalton parish council galaWebFeb 15, 2024 · If you want to eliminate technology debt, then stop using open source libraries and frameworks, advised Robert Lefkowitz, the recently retired Chief Architect of eyewear provider Warby Parker. “If you don’t want tech debt, avoid using libraries or frameworks,” Lefkowitz said, speaking during his popular annual talk at the O’Reilly … dalton pa food pantryWebNov 19, 2024 · Generally speaking, we can say technical debt describes what happens when a development team expedites the delivery of functionality or software which later needs … bird drip irrigationWebJul 18, 2016 · Technical debt is not a physical thing, it’s a metaphor developed by Ward Cunningham that helps you think about the problem behind it. Technical debt means that some parts of your system were made the “easy” way without taking care of the quality of the code written. bird drive recharge area